Output e6580dcc19bcbe33b871ce806a64740db569f5061a27161d554ed6cb8fac6682:11

value
26402874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c77db17868780569b1e09331d0720688ecc858c5 OP_EQUAL
address
MS5yGvYx7ZheEDvfZ9NzSzcfJUULrV41qP
transaction
e6580dcc19bcbe33b871ce806a64740db569f5061a27161d554ed6cb8fac6682
spent
true